Cronin Genealogy & History

Cronin comes from the Old Gaelic O'Croneen, meaning son of the saffron-colored man. Because the name is now found largely in Ireland, and yellow hair is more often attributed to Norsemen than to the Irish, Cronin family history speculates that the family name originated from modern Scandinavia. Many Cronins reside in County Limerick and County Kerry today. Spelling variations include Cronyn, Cronine, Croynin, Cronan, Cronnin, Cronnan, Cronnyn, Cronen, O'Cronin, and Croynan. Cronin genealogy lays claim to Scottish doctor and novelist A. J. Cronin, Irish poet Anthony Cronin, American physicist James Watson Cronin, and one-term Massachusetts Representative Paul W. Cronin.
